CVE-2022-42435: Security Bulletin: Security vulnerabilities are addressed with IBM Cloud Pak for Business Automation iFixes for December 2022

IBM Business Automation Workflow 18.0.0, 18.0.1, 18.0.2, 19.0.1, 19.0.2, 19.0.3, 20.0.1, 20.0.2, 20.0.3, 21.0.1, 21.0.2, 21.0.3, and 22.0.1 is vulnerable to cross-site request forgery which could allow an attacker to execute malicious and unauthorized actions transmitted from a user that the website trusts. IBM X-Force ID: 238054.

Security Bulletin

Summary

In addition to many updates of operating system level packages, the following security vulnerability is addressed with IBM Cloud Pak for Business Automation 21.0.3-IF016 and 22.0.1-IF006.

Vulnerability Details

CVEID: CVE-2017-10355
DESCRIPTION: An unspecified vulnerability in Oracle Java SE related to the Java SE, Java SE Embedded, JRockit Networking component could allow an unauthenticated attacker to cause a denial of service resulting in a low availability impact using unknown attack vectors.
CVSS Base score: 5.3
CVSS Temporal Score: See: https://exchange.xforce.ibmcloud.com/vulnerabilities/133784 for the current score.
CVSS Vector: (CVSS:3.0/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:N/I:N/A:L)

CVEID: CVE-2022-42920
DESCRIPTION: Apache Commons BCEL could allow a remote attacker to bypass security restrictions, caused by an out-of-bounds write flaw in the APIs. By sending a specially-crafted request, an attacker could exploit this vulnerability to gain control over the resulting bytecode than otherwise expected.
CVSS Base score: 9.8
CVSS Temporal Score: See: https://exchange.xforce.ibmcloud.com/vulnerabilities/239562 for the current score.
CVSS Vector: (CVSS:3.0/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H)

CVEID: CVE-2022-2047
DESCRIPTION: Eclipse Jetty could allow a remote authenticated attacker to bypass security restrictions, caused by a flaw in the HttpURI class. By sending a specially-crafted request, an attacker could exploit this vulnerability to the HttpClient and ProxyServlet/AsyncProxyServlet/AsyncMiddleManServlet wrongly interpreting an authority with no host as one with a host.
CVSS Base score: 2.7
CVSS Temporal Score: See: https://exchange.xforce.ibmcloud.com/vulnerabilities/230668 for the current score.
CVSS Vector: (CVSS:3.0/AV:N/AC:L/PR:H/UI:N/S:U/C:N/I:L/A:N)

CVEID: CVE-2022-42435
DESCRIPTION: IBM Business Automation Workflow is vulnerable to cross-site request forgery which could allow an attacker to execute malicious and unauthorized actions transmitted from a user that the website trusts.
CVSS Base score: 4.3
CVSS Temporal Score: See: https://exchange.xforce.ibmcloud.com/vulnerabilities/238054 for the current score.
CVSS Vector: (CVSS:3.0/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:R/S:U/C:N/I:L/A:N)

GHSA-97xg-phpr-rg8q: Apache Commons BCEL vulnerable to out-of-bounds write

Apache Commons BCEL has a number of APIs that would normally only allow changing specific class characteristics. However, due to an out-of-bounds writing issue, these APIs can be used to produce arbitrary bytecode. This could be abused in applications that pass attacker-controllable data to those APIs, giving the attacker more control over the resulting bytecode than otherwise expected. Update to Apache Commons BCEL 6.6.0.

CVE-2022-2047

In Eclipse Jetty versions 9.4.0 thru 9.4.46, and 10.0.0 thru 10.0.9, and 11.0.0 thru 11.0.9 versions, the parsing of the authority segment of an http scheme URI, the Jetty HttpURI class improperly detects an invalid input as a hostname. This can lead to failures in a Proxy scenario.

GHSA-cj7v-27pg-wf7q: Invalid URI parsing may produce invalid HttpURI.authority

### Description URI use within Jetty's `HttpURI` class can parse invalid URIs such as `http://localhost;/path` as having an authority with a host of `localhost;`. A URIs of the type `http://localhost;/path` should be interpreted to be either invalid or as `localhost;` to be the userinfo and no host. However, `HttpURI.host` returns `localhost;` which is definitely wrong. ### Impact This can lead to errors with Jetty's `HttpClient`, and Jetty's `ProxyServlet` / `AsyncProxyServlet` / `AsyncMiddleManServlet` wrongly interpreting an authority with no host as one with a host. ### Patches Patched in PR [#8146](https://github.com/eclipse/jetty.project/pull/8146) for Jetty version 9.4.47.
